Property Details for 151-153 Sundown Ct, Tamborine

151-153 Sundown Ct, Tamborine is a 6 bedroom, 4 bathroom House with 6 parking spaces and was built in 1988. The property has a land size of 101800m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in June 2020.

About Tamborine 4270

The size of Tamborine is approximately 71.2 square kilometres. It has 18 parks covering nearly 28.9% of total area. The population of Tamborine in 2016 was 3950 people. By 2021 the population was 4388 showing a population growth of 11.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Tamborine is 50-59 years. Households in Tamborine are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Tamborine work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 87.60% of the homes in Tamborine were owner-occupied compared with 85.20% in 2016.

Tamborine has 1,610 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Tamborine have seen a 86.27%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 177.55% increase. As at 30 November 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Tamborine is $1,361,102 while the median value for Units is $945,533.
  • Houses have a median rent of $700.
There are currently 6 properties listed for sale, and 2 properties listed for rent in Tamborine on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 73 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Tamborine.
